Output 15928e5e0c4a757b2f101bad86f161a73af60040dd7c5d0abc78d6bbcdbf6665:16

value
502000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bc8fb951adb7e70371834164ee28d19a0eb1d19 OP_EQUALVERIFY OP_CHECKSIG
address
14zWpmveou9D6uLDYzY8747TpN4fWfLPaQ
transaction
15928e5e0c4a757b2f101bad86f161a73af60040dd7c5d0abc78d6bbcdbf6665
spent
true